Man City v Bayer Leverkusen
Tuesday November 25
KO 20:00
Live on TNT
Bet #1 - Back Haaland to strike in comfortable home win
The Stat
Man City have scored 10 goals across their four Champions League matches - the same number as Leverkusen have conceded - and hit four last time out when they hosted Borussia Dortmund. Erling Haaland is the competition's top goalscorer with five and it is worth backing him to add to that tally in another comfortable home win.
The Bet
Back Man City -2 and Haaland to score
Bet #2 - Back
The Stat
Manchester City's Jérémy Doku has won 3+ fouls in four of his previous five UEFA Champions League appearances. We can back him at odds-against to do exactly that again on Tuesday night. It's an opportunity we cannot pass up.
The Bet
Back Doku to be foul 3+ times
Bet #3 - Back
The Stat
In each of his three appearances in the UEFA Champions League this season, Manchester City's Phil Foden has recorded 2+ shots and created 2+ chances. He scored twice in the 4-1 demolition of Dortmund and, with a point to prove to England manager Thomas Tuchel, could relish the continental stage again.
The Bet
Back Foden 1+ SOTs in each half
